Manufacturers of oil filters, brake pads, or belts frequently stamp date codes directly onto components. For instance, a rubber timing belt marked JUL448 might indicate production in July of a specific year (the year being implied elsewhere on the part or packaging). Mechanics and restorers often decode such markings to verify original equipment status.
